Transaction 8073a130bb82e29080b74fda4f1bf26bc7c3b7911a520b2889bcde626dcadb21
1 Input
1 Output
-
8073a130bb82e29080b74fda4f1bf26bc7c3b7911a520b2889bcde626dcadb21:0
- value
- 15884937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 250d939144ccf8ae139a19d65c76e770cb028466 OP_EQUAL
- address
- 354wBwyqV22eRTvVtUdfZE1Jcww3dUptCc